Overview
Direct Support Professional role at Devereux Massachusetts, Rutland, MA. Compensation starts at $20.50/hour, with additional compensation up to $23.87/hour for higher education and/or years of relevant experience. Shifts available: 7am-3pm, 3pm-11pm, 11pm-9am.
Responsibilities
Be passionate about working with and helping youth.
Be responsible for the safety and security of all youth as assigned by providing direct supervision.
Provide and ensure therapeutic interventions in a compassionate and safe environment.
Engage with youth in a meaningful and positive manner, teaching and prompting appropriate behaviors, and providing positive reinforcement for the same.
Teach and assist with Activities of Daily Living (ADL) skills.
Possess adequate organizational and communication skills needed to complete required documentation, such as progress notes and incident reports.
Qualifications
Must be 21 years of age or older.
Valid driver’s license required.
High School diploma or GED required. Bachelor’s degree in a related field preferred.
Previous experience working with individuals under 21 with psychological, emotional, and behavioral disorders, and/or autism spectrum disorders preferred.
Must be able to attend a 2-week paid orientation, Monday to Friday, 8:00 AM to 4:00 PM, in Rutland, MA.
Must be MAPS certified, or able to obtain certification within 90 days of employment if working in a Group Home setting.
